What is a physical change?

Back

A physical change is a change that affects one or more physical properties of a substance without altering its chemical composition. Examples include melting, freezing, and dissolving.

What is a chemical change?

Back

A chemical change occurs when a substance transforms into a different substance with different properties. This often involves a chemical reaction.

What is the melting point?

Back

The melting point is the temperature at which a solid becomes a liquid. For example, butter melts at a specific temperature when heated.

What is the boiling point?

Back

The boiling point is the temperature at which a liquid turns into vapor. For example, water boils at 100 degrees Celsius at sea level.

What is a biome?

Back

A biome is a large geographical area characterized by specific climate conditions, plants, and animals. Examples include forests, deserts, and tundras.

What biome is Mississippi primarily classified as?

Back

Mississippi is primarily classified as a deciduous forest biome, which features trees that lose their leaves in the fall.

What happens during the process of chopping vegetables?

Back

Chopping vegetables is a physical change because it alters the size and shape of the vegetables without changing their chemical composition.
